In the gpu comparison between the EVGA GeForce RTX 2060 GAMING and the KFA2 GeForce GTX 1080 EX OC, we compare both the technical data and the benchmark results of the two graphics cards.

GPU

The EVGA GeForce RTX 2060 GAMING is based on the NVIDIA GeForce RTX 2060 and has 1920 texture shaders and 30 execution units.

KFA2 GeForce GTX 1080 EX OC is based on NVIDIA GeForce GTX 1080, which has 2560 shaders and 20 execution units.

Memory

The EVGA GeForce RTX 2060 GAMING has 6 GB of graphics memory of the type GDDR6 and achieves a memory bandwidth of 336 GB/s.

The KFA2 GeForce GTX 1080 EX OC can access 8 GB GDDR5X graphics memory and thus achieves a memory bandwidth of 320 GB/s.

Thermal Design

The TDP (Thermal Design Power) of the EVGA GeForce RTX 2060 GAMING is 160 W. The graphics card is supplied with energy via the 1 x 8-Pin connector.

The KFA2 GeForce GTX 1080 EX OC has a TDP of 180 W and is supplied with the required energy via 1 x 6-Pin, 1 x 8-Pin PCIe power connectors.

Additional data

The EVGA GeForce RTX 2060 GAMING was released in Q1/2019 at a price of 349 $ (Reference).

The KFA2 GeForce GTX 1080 EX OC was introduced in Q2/2016 at a price of 599 $ (Reference).
